Not far from the southwest of Shi Peng, stands a big Zhaotou Cliff, facing the sun and lee, facing a relatively flat grassland. When tourists rest here, they will have an extraordinary feeling of melting into greenery in the face of the verdant South Mountain that covers the sky. According to legend, Shi learned to play the piano here, drinking and having fun. Therefore, in the Ming Dynasty, people carved six "Shi Manqing reading rooms" between the ancient stone walls in Han Li, which went deep into the stone bones and were simple and lovely.

History, real name Yan Nian, word. Born in the fifth year of Chunhua in the Northern Song Dynasty (994), he died in the second year of Kangding (104 1). His ancestors were from Youzhou (present-day Beijing area). In order to escape the Qidan rebellion, his family moved south and settled in Song Cheng, Songzhou (present-day Shangqiu City, Henan Province).

Shi has a good friend named, who used to be an official, but was accused. Shi put in a good word for his good friend and was also implicated. He was banished from Beijing to Haizhou for minor punishment. Tongguan is a well-known deputy and also has the responsibility of supervising local officials, also known as prison state.

Shi was a famous writer, poet and calligrapher at that time, and wrote the poem "Shi". Shipeng Mountain has beautiful scenery and is close to the Great Wall, so it has become a place where he often plays.

What history admires most is his indomitable patriotism. In the fifth year of the Northern Song Dynasty (1038), the Xixia King was renamed Emperor, with the title of Daxia, indicating that it was in a completely equal position with the Northern Song Dynasty. From the first year to the second year of Kangding, Xixia launched a large-scale military invasion to the Northern Song Dynasty once or twice every year, and often defeated Song Jun. In a short time, it organized hundreds of thousands of troops from Hebei, Hedong and Shaanxi to go to the front to resist Xixia. So, the emperor gave him a whitebait, and when he was ready to reuse it, the stone was in poor health. Exactly: dying at the end of ambition often makes heroes cry!

Shi was only 48 years old when he died, and he was the official to the prince Zhongyun and the manager of the Secret Pavilion School.
